London Waterloo Station is replete with facilities designed to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. Its ticket office operates from 5:30 AM to 11:15 PM during we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ly adjusted times on Sundays. For those who prefer to plan their travels in advance, ticket machines are available on the main concourse, making online ticket collection straightforward and accessible. Moreover, there's an induction loop system making communication easy for the hearing impaired.
Accessibility is one of the key strengths of Waterloo Station, with step-free access available throughout. The station is ably equipped to cater to the needs of all passengers, featuring accessible toilets, ramps for train access, and seating areas to ensure comfort. Help points, dedicated staff assistance, and an extensive customer service offering guarantee that you’re never without support.

Moving beyond the platforms, London Waterloo Station acts as a dynamic node connecting you with London and beyond. With a dedicated taxi rank and a close-knit relationship with London's extensive bus and Underground services, getting around is both straightforward and efficient. Waterloo Underground station is served by several lines, including the Bakerloo, Jubilee, Northern, and Waterloo & City lines making your planning effortless.
For those looking to explore the city on two wheels, Santander Cycle hire bikes are available nearby. The station's proximity to the South Bank makes it an inviting starting point for a leisurely stroll or cycle along the riverside for a touch of culture and picturesque views.

Nestled in the heart of Kent, Ashford International train station is more than just a transport hub—it's a vibrant stepping stone to some of the UK's most exciting destinations. With its strategic position on the High-Speed 1 rail line, Ashford International links travelers to London and across Europe, offering expedient connections that bring the world closer to your doorstep.
Stepping into Ashford International, travelers are greeted with modern, accessible facilities designed to make the journey as seamless as possible. The station offers extensive ticketing options, including a ticket office open from the early hours of 5:30 am until 9:30 pm, Monday through Saturday, and a slightly later start at 6:00 am on Sundays. Ticket machines are widely available for self-service, with provisions for accessibility.
For those needing special assistance, Ashford International offers comprehensive support, including an induction loop, customer help points, and step-free access across the entire station. Waiting rooms and shelters provide comfort, with heated facilities on select platforms, while seating areas cater to travelers needing a respite between connections.
Ashford International is more than just a station—it's a launchpad for effortless onward travel. Whether you’re looking for a traditional taxi on Station Approach Road or planning to hire a bicycle from the convenient Brompton Dock, the station offers various options to suit your travel needs. Keep in mind the handy rail replacement services available from the forecourt outside the booking hall, ensuring continuity of your journey even during disruptions.
